How CPR feels in real life, and what training provides you

I commonly tell trainees that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is easy, challenging. The formula is simple: press set in the facility of the upper body, enable recoil, and reduce disturbances. In technique, fatigue embed in quickly. After 2 mins, most people's deepness or rhythm slides. Educating fixes this by mentor body mechanics that save your wrists and shoulders, and by giving you a metronome sense of pace.

Here are the key points you will certainly practice in a CPR course Joondalup:

  • Compression price generally 100 to 120 per minute, deepness about 5 to 6 cm on an adult chest
  •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
  • A 30 to 2 ratio of compressions to breaths for a single rescuer, unless a course or office policy specifies compression-only in specific scenarios
  • Early AED usage, with pads placed correctly, following triggers, and clearing before shock

The best classes press you to handle the small stuff under time stress: asking for an AED without quiting compressions, exchanging rescuers every two mins, tilting the head and lifting the chin to open up the respiratory tract, and fitting a pocket mask without leaking half the breath into the room.

Legal cover, obligations, and what you can do

An usual concern seems like this: what happens if I make it even worse? Western Australia's Civil Responsibility Act consists of Do-gooder securities that cover people that act in excellent confidence and without assumption of settlement when offering emergency support. In plain terms, if you supply practical first aid in an emergency, the regulation is made to safeguard you. Training courses in Joondalup clarify the limits of what an initial aider ought to do. You can use an epinephrine auto-injector when suitable, assist somebody to use their recommended medication, or carry out oxygen in some offices if trained and permitted. You do not diagnose intricate conditions, and you do not give drugs past the scope of training and policy.

Documentation issues too. In work environments, occurrence kinds help tape what occurred, who was included, and the timeline of actions. A brief, factual log reinforces handover to paramedics and supports any type of later review.

How typically to freshen and why it deserves it

Skills discolor. Even certain first aiders drop details after six to twelve months without technique. Australian support generally advises a yearly update for CPR and every 3 years for the wider Offer First Aid device. That rhythm strikes a great equilibrium. In a refresh, you capture adjustments that creep in over time, such as updated asthma emergency treatment steps, anaphylaxis monitoring guidance, or simple improvements to AED pad placement diagrams.

Timing, price, and logistics without the surprises

You can finish HLTAID009 CPR in a single session, typically 2 to 3 hours including the useful element, with brief pre-course concept online. HLTAID011 first aid generally takes a lot of a day when paired with on-line components, often 5 to 7 hours face to face relying on course dimension and speed. Rates in Joondalup vary with provider and inclusions, usually landing in a series of around 65 to 110 AUD for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and 120 to 180 AUD for the complete first aid system. Specialised child care units might sit a bit greater. Group bookings for offices typically feature discussed rates and, sometimes, on-site distribution if you have a suitable room.

A realistic image of outcomes

CPR does not guarantee survival. Absolutely nothing does. What it changes is the odds.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make an extensive distinction. If an AED provides a shock within the initial few minutes of a shockable heart attack, survival can increase a number of times compared to delayed intervention. That is why having actually educated people in a work environment or neighborhood center matters. In Joondalup, a busy shopping center or sports facility can organize hundreds of site visitors daily. Someone with a certificate, a cool head, and the desire to start is usually the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.

How long does first aid training last in WA?

First aid training in Western Australia typically takes one to two days depending on the course level. Basic courses often include both theory and practical assessment. Some refresher courses may be completed in less time. Certification is usually valid for a set period before renewal is required.

How often is CPR training required in Australia?

CPR training in Australia is generally recommended to be refreshed every 12 months. This ensures skills remain current and aligned with updated guidelines. Some workplaces require annual renewal as part of safety compliance. CPR techniques can change over time, making regular updates important.

What are common CPR mistakes?

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
